METALLICA RELEASE NEW SONG, “LORDS OF SUMMER,” ON iTUNES

Metallica have officially released their new song, Lords of Summer, through iTunes. The new song, which is technically titled Lords Of Summer (First Pass Version), clocks in at over eight minutes long. THE METAL GOD, ROB HALFORD, EXPLAINS WHY HE TRADEMARKED NAME

Judas Priest frontman Rob Halford has explained why he trademarked the phrase “Metal God” in 2009. He took the legal step to ensure the name couldn’t be used in commercial ventures like computer games. But he’s previously said he’s not fully comfortable with using it himself.
